统计211

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 8930|回复: 11
打印 上一主题 下一主题

关于第二讲的一个问题

[复制链接]
跳转到指定楼层
1
发表于 2013-8-9 09:40:30 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
第二讲中,冯老师讲到 “nouniquekey” 选项,

proc sort nouniquekey out=bb;
by id;
.......


个人在SAS9.2中练习,该语句错误,无法运行,求各位同学帮忙:

1) 有同学运行处这个程序吗?

2)还是SAS9.2 和9.3的区别?

备注:noduplicate 选项可以运行。
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 转播转播 分享分享 分享淘帖 支持支持 反对反对
2
发表于 2013-8-9 13:10:55 | 只看该作者
把log的提示贴出来看看
3
发表于 2013-8-9 16:58:53 | 只看该作者
本帖最后由 henryyhl 于 2013-8-9 17:01 编辑

刚才看了一下,是9.3新加的选择项。详见:http://support.sas.com/documenta ... #procwhatsnew93.htm
但是这个选项是什么具体作用?求教
4
发表于 2013-8-9 17:16:03 | 只看该作者
henryyhl 发表于 2013-8-9 16:58
刚才看了一下,是9.3新加的选择项。详见:http://support.sas.com/documentation/cdl/en/whatsnew/64209/HT ...

在网站http://support.sas.com/documenta ... 4n1b6l00ftdnxge.htm
看到这个:
NOUNIQUEKEY
checks for and eliminates observations from the output data set that have a unique sort key. A sort key is unique when the observation containing the key is the only observation within a BY group. An observation has a unique sort key when it is the only observation within a BY group.
Note: Unlike NODUPKEY, which writes one observation of a BY group to the output data set and discards all other observations from the BY group, the NOUNIQUEKEY maintains BY group integrity. Either all observations of a BY group are written to the output data set when the BY group consists of two or more observations, or all observations of the BY group are discarded when the BY group consists of a single observation.
Alias:NOUNIKEY | NOUNIKEYS | NOUNIQUEKEYS
大概就是说如果by变量的某个值只有一个观测的话就删除,如果该by变量的值有多个观测则保留这些观测。
这是9.3上新加的,本人用的还是9.2,没法测试啊。
5
发表于 2013-8-9 20:37:55 | 只看该作者
henryyhl 发表于 2013-8-9 17:16
在网站http://support.sas.com/documentation/cdl/en/proc/65145/HTML/default/viewer.htm#p02bhn81rn4u6 ...

可能是我课上没讲清楚?这个的作用就是保留重复的观测,是sas9.3新加的
6
发表于 2013-8-9 21:18:17 | 只看该作者
国双 发表于 2013-8-9 20:37
可能是我课上没讲清楚?这个的作用就是保留重复的观测,是sas9.3新加的

可能是我们当时听得不仔细,有些东西还是回来自己跑程序出问题 了才知道。
多向冯老师学习。
7
 楼主| 发表于 2013-8-9 21:19:23 | 只看该作者
国双 发表于 2013-8-9 20:37
可能是我课上没讲清楚?这个的作用就是保留重复的观测,是sas9.3新加的

谢谢冯老师,呵呵,我说SAS9.2怎么运行不了呢?看来软件该更新了。。。。
8
 楼主| 发表于 2013-8-9 21:19:47 | 只看该作者
henryyhl 发表于 2013-8-9 17:16
在网站http://support.sas.com/documentation/cdl/en/proc/65145/HTML/default/viewer.htm#p02bhn81rn4u6 ...

谢谢海亮啊,哈哈。。。
9
发表于 2013-8-10 19:42:16 | 只看该作者
☆回头是岸★ 发表于 2013-8-9 21:19
谢谢海亮啊,哈哈。。。

原来如此~~你们谁有9.3啊
10
发表于 2013-8-11 09:12:53 | 只看该作者
ぺ蘖莎い 发表于 2013-8-10 19:42
原来如此~~你们谁有9.3啊

可以在人大论坛或百度上搜一下,但是我的一个老师装了9.3之后好像还没有9.2的快呢。不知道什么原因,然后他就换回9.2了
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则


免责声明|关于我们|小黑屋|联系我们|赞助我们|统计211 ( 闽ICP备09019626号  

GMT+8, 2025-4-3 11:30 , Processed in 0.091989 second(s), 24 queries .

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表